Changes in plasma dolichol levels, transport, and hepatic delivery during rat liver regeneration.

Abstract

During the proliferative process that follows partial hepatectomy in the rat, the dolichol content increases in both plasma and liver. Its transport in the blood by lipoproteins also changes. The difference in the distribution of dolichols of various chain lengths in plasma and in the liver is further enhanced during liver regeneration. The dolichol released by perfused liver shows a homologue distribution more similar to that observable in blood than in the liver, thus confirming the importance of the liver as a regulatory site for the blood dolichol supply.
